Outboard Motor Power Pack Buying Guide
Outboard motor power packs serve as critical auxiliary power sources designed to provide reliable starting power and electrical support for outboard engines. They are especially useful for anglers, boat owners, and marine users who need a dependable means to start and maintain their outboard motors during fishing trips or boating excursions.
These power packs typically consist of high-capacity batteries or battery packs paired with integrated power management systems that can help maintain voltage stability and provide surge power when starting engines. They are often built to withstand marine environments, featuring corrosion-resistant components and waterproof housings, making them practical tools for both freshwater and saltwater applications.

Safety & Compliance Must-Knows
Safety and regulatory compliance form the foundation for any outboard motor power pack purchase or installation. Ensuring your power pack meets marine standards and is installed according to professional guidelines can help mitigate risks associated with electrical failures or environmental exposure.
- Verify the power pack’s marine certification and IP rating for water and dust resistance.
- Ensure compatibility with your outboard motor’s voltage and starting requirements.
- Consult with a qualified marine electrician or technician before installation.
- Check local boating regulations regarding battery storage and electrical system modifications.
- Use corrosion-resistant terminals and secure mounting hardware designed for marine use.
Quick Decision Guide
Use these questions to clarify your needs before you start searching online:
- What is the size and horsepower of my outboard motor? → This influences the power pack’s required capacity and Cold Cranking Amps.
- Will I be operating mostly in saltwater or freshwater environments? → Saltwater requires more corrosion-resistant and waterproof features.
- What is my skill level with marine electrical systems? → Determines if you should seek plug-and-play options or professional installation.
- Are there specific regulatory or safety certifications necessary for my area? → Compliance affects product choice and installation requirements.

Lithium Ion Outboard Motor Power Pack
Lithium ion power packs are designed to provide lightweight, high-capacity power ideal for anglers and boaters who prioritize portability and endurance.
These units are often chosen for extended trips where weight savings and rapid recharging can support prolonged use. They typically feature multiple output options, including USB ports for charging accessories, and marine-grade waterproof housings to withstand exposure. However, they may come at a higher initial cost and require compatible chargers.
Search For Specs Like: 12V 20Ah capacity, waterproof IP67 rating, integrated USB ports.
Ideal For: Applications requiring lightweight, portable power with extended run times.

Sealed Lead Acid (SLA) Outboard Motor Power Pack
SLA power packs are often used for cost-effective, maintenance-free starting power with a sealed design that prevents acid leaks.
These packs can support reliable engine starts without the need for regular water topping or maintenance, making them popular for casual boaters and anglers. They generally have a higher weight compared to lithium packs but are widely available and compatible with most outboard motors. Consider vibration resistance and CCA ratings when selecting this type.
Search For Specs Like: 12V 35Ah capacity, 400+ CCA, vibration resistant casing.
Ideal For: Users seeking affordable, rugged power packs with minimal upkeep.

Portable Marine Battery Power Pack
Portable packs are compact power sources intended for small boats and easy transport between vessels or storage.
They usually offer built-in safety features such as overload protection and short circuit prevention. Their rugged enclosures and weatherproofing help them endure marine conditions, and they may include multiple output ports for powering accessories alongside engine starts. These packs are suitable for users who need flexibility and convenience.
Search For Specs Like: Rechargeable, 12V 10Ah capacity, short circuit protection.
Ideal For: Small boat operators requiring convenient, portable power solutions.

12V Marine Battery Power Pack
Standard 12V marine battery packs are designed to match the voltage requirements of most outboard motors and marine electronics.
They typically feature corrosion-resistant terminals and meet marine certification standards. These power packs often support both starting and auxiliary power needs, making them versatile for various boat sizes. Checking amperage output and ensuring compatibility with the engine’s start system is crucial when selecting these units.
Search For Specs Like: 12V 50Ah capacity, marine-certified, corrosion-resistant terminals.
Ideal For: Boats requiring reliable 12V power with robust marine-grade construction.

Dual Battery System Power Pack
Dual battery systems provide redundancy and extended power capacity, often used on larger boats with higher power demands.
These systems incorporate isolator switches or battery management systems to balance loads and prevent over-discharge. They support longer trips and additional electrical loads such as trolling motors and onboard electronics. Proper installation hardware and matched battery capacities are key considerations for system reliability.
Search For Specs Like: Battery isolator included, matched 12V batteries, mounting hardware.
Ideal For: Larger vessels requiring redundant power sources and extended battery life.

Comparing Your Options
The main differences between outboard motor power pack types lie in their weight, capacity, maintenance needs, and intended use environments. Lithium ion packs are lightweight and efficient but generally cost more, while sealed lead acid models offer budget-friendly durability. Portable packs prioritize mobility, whereas dual battery systems focus on redundancy and extended power for larger vessels.
